The Big Bang Theory Review: "The Benefactor Factor"

"The Benefactor Factor" was wall-to-wall one-liners, and that isn't necessarily a bad thing.

While the plot was about as stale and traditional as they come, it was rather humorous seeing Sheldon trying to pimp out Leonard in order to get funding for the latest scientific gizmos. The overnight bag complete with baby oil, prophylactics and Viagra's more virile older brother actually made me chuckle, as did Sheldon's oddly proud reaction to Leonard actually having done the deed.

I've only recently discovered the brilliance that is Arrested Development, so it was a nice surprise to see Jessica Walter as the rich and raunchy benefactor trying to grab a romp with Leonard in exchange for funding. 

She was a less caustic version of Mrs. Bluth, but still reveled in making other people uncomfortable and I enjoyed Raj's reactions to her at the fundraiser. Her diss at Howard's lack of a Ph.D. would have made Sheldon proud.

Penny wasn't particularly on the forefront, but her responses to Sheldon's barbs were dead on, especially his "complimentary" observation that her expertise would serve Leonard well in his particular predicament. And as much as I believe her interactions with Sheldon are the lifeblood of this series, I'm beginning to enjoy Sheldon's cyber chats with Amy, as well.  While he and Penny function hilariously as oil and water, something about the like-mindedness of both he and Amy seems to also work.

Overall, I thought it was a decent episode.  What did you think?  Let us know in the comments below, and be sure to check out some quotes:
